TRB Webinar: Understanding and Mitigating Disease Transmission at Airports |
|
|
TRB will conduct a webinar on September 19, 2013 from 2:00 p.m.- 3:30 p.m. ET that will feature research conducted by TRB’s Airport Cooperative Research Program (ACRP) on potential disease outbreaks associated with air travel and tools to assist with mitigating such events. Participants must register in advance of the webinar, and there is no fee...

Strategies to Mitigate the Impacts of Chloride Roadway Deicers on the Natural Environment |
|
|
TRB’s National Cooperative Highway Research Program (NCHRP) Report 449: Strategies to Mitigate the Impacts of Chloride Roadway Deicers on the Natural Environment documents the range of methods, tools, and techniques used by transportation agencies to minimize the environmental impact of chloride-based roadway deicers.

Evaluation of Superpave Mixtures Containing Hydrated Lime |
|
|
The Louisiana Transportation Research Center has released a report that evaluates the engineering properties of hot-mix asphalt (HMA) mixtures containing hydrated lime as compared to conventional mixtures, and the influence of hydrated lime on the mechanical properties of HMA mixtures.
